HomeMy WebLinkAboutORD NO 3361ORDINANCE NO. 3361 AN ORDINANCE AMENDING TITLE SEVENTEEN OF THE BAKERSFIELD MUNICIPAL CODE AND CITY ZONING MAPS NO. 123-26, 123-27 AND 123-28 BY PREZONING PROPERTY LOCATED SOUTH OF PANAMA LANE, EAST OF GOSFORD ROAD KNOWN AS THE ASHE NO. 2 ANNEXATION (WARD 6). WHEREAS, in accordance with the procedure set forth in the provisions of Title 17 of the Municipal Code of the City of Bakersfield, the Planning Commission held a public hearing on a request by the City of Bakersfield to zone certain property now being annexed to said City and made several general and specific findings of fact which warranted a negative declaration of environmental impact; and WHEREAS, Ashe No. 2 Annexation prezoning area comprises 918 +/- acres of land contiguous to the boundary of the City of Bakersfield; and WHEREAS, at said public hearing held on April 4, 1991, said zoning upon annexation was duly heard and considered and the Planning Commission found as follows: 1. Proposed Zoning Upon Annexation designations will not have a significant adverse effect on the environment. 2. Public necessity, convenience, general welfare and good planning practice justify the proposed Zoning Upon Annexation to R-1 (One Family Dwelling) Zone, A-20A (Agricultural~ 20-acre minimum lot size) and RS-10A (Residential Suburban 10-acre minimum lot size) Zone. 3. Proposed Zoning Upon Annexation designations would be in conformance with the Metropolitan Bakersfield 2010 General Plan. 4. The proposed prezoning is consistent with existing land use in the area. 5. The proposed Zoning Upon Annexation would be compat- ible with future and existing development on the surrounding properties. 6. Public participation and notification requirements pursuant to Sections 65090 and 65353 of the Government Code of the State of California were duly followed. WHEREAS, by Resolution No. 19-91 on April 4, 1991, the Planning Commission recommended approval and adoption of an ordinance amending Title 17 of the Municipal Code to approve an R-1 (One Family Dwelling) Zone, A-20A (Agricultural, 20-acre mini-- mum lot size) Zone and RS-10A (Residential Suburban, 10-acre mini- mum site area per dwelling) Zone, with conditions of approval on attached Exhibit A and with mitigation on attached Exhibit B, as herein described and as delineated on the attached maps marked Exhibit C, Exhibit D and Exhibit E by this Council and this Council has fully considered the findings made by the Planning Commission as set fo:rth in that Resolution; and WHEREAS, there appears to be no substantial detrimental environmental impact which could result from this zoning action; and WHEREAS, a Negative Declaration was advertised and posted on March 14, 1991 in accordance with CEQA; and WHEREAS, the proposed zoning substantially conforms to and is consistent with the General Plan; and WHEREAS, the City Council has determined after due con- sideration of the motion and recommendation of the Planning Commission, herein on file, together with the reasons advanced at the Planning Commission hearing, that said zoning should be authorized upon annexation of said property to the City. N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T ORDAINED by the Council of the City of Bakersfield as follows: SECTION 1. 1. All the foregoing recitals are found to be true and correct. 2. The Negative Declaration for this zoning action is hereby approved and adopted. 3. That Title Seventeen of the Bakersfield Municipal Code of the City of Bakersfield and City Zoning Maps No. 123-26, No. 123-27 and No. 123-28 be and the same is hereby amended by prezoning said property and extending the boundaries of said maps to include that certain property in the County of Kern generally located south of Panama Lane, east of Gosford Road contiguous to the boundary of the City of Bakersfield known as the ASHE NO. 2 ANNEXATION, upon the annexation of said property to the City of Bakersfield, the zoning designations and boundaries of which prop- erty are shown on the maps, hereto attached and made a part of this ordinance, and are more specifically described as follows: - 2 - FROM COUNTY A (EXCLUSIVE AGRICULTURAL) ZONE TO CITY R-1 (ONE FAMILY DWELLING) ZONE: The North ½ of Section 28; the north ½ of Section 27; the southeast ¼ of Section 27 and the south 330 feet of the southwest ¼ of the southwest ¼ of Section 26 in Township 30 South, Range 27 East, M.D.B.&M., County of Kern, State of California, according to the official plats thereof EXCEPTING the east 600 feet of the northeast of said Section 27. Public Works Department The annexation area is within a proposed freeway corridor. Reservations may be necessary at the time of development to reserve areas for future freeway right-of-way. Prior to approval of any subdivision map, the applicant shall submit a traffic study to the City Engineer for approval establishing traffic impacts resulting from the change in zoning and recommending appropriate mitigation measures. The cost of the mitigation measures shall be borne by the applicant. The applicant shall submit a comprehensive drainage study. The drainage study should include, but not necessarily be limited to, drainage calculations, pipe sizes and locations, drainage basin sites and sizes, and construction phasing. The drainage study shall be submitted to and approved by the City Engineer and the required drainage basin site and neces- sary easements deeded to the city prior to recording of any subdivision map or submittal of any development plan within the project area. p/sra2ea EXHIBIT "B" Mitigation Measure Ashe No. 2 Annexation EXHIBIT "B" Mitigation Measure Ashe No. 2 Annexation Zoning Upon Annexation #5124 An archaeological survey is required for any proposal within the project area prior to site disturbance.
